About this restaurant

Address: 4420 Walnut St, Philadelphia, PA 19104

Manakeesh Cafe Bakery & Grill in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ania serves up authentic Lebanese cuisine with an extensive menu featuring freshly baked flatbreads, grilled meats, and traditional mezze dishes. The restaurant's signature offerings include their house-made pita bread straight from the oven, flavorful chicken tawook, and what many consider to be the city's best baklava. Their commitment to halal preparation, generous portions, and diverse menu that includes both traditional Middle Eastern favorites and fusion dishes has made them a beloved fixture in West Philadelphia's dining scene.

Portion SizesReviews are mixed regarding portion sizes. Some describe them as generous and large enough for two meals, while others mention smaller portions than before.

PricesCustomer opinions on pricing are divided. Some find the food affordable and good value, while others criticize it as expensive, especially considering the quality or quantity received.

ParkingParking is noted as a negative aspect for some customers, citing difficulty in finding parking nearby.
